Lars Petter Sjöström, gouache, signed L.P. Sjöström and dated 1890
Ship portrait, "Maria Adelaid from Hvitemölle Captain S.H. Sjöström", image area 43x57 cm
Not examined out of frame. Worming.
On the back label with the following information: Maria Adelaide
Built in Danzig in 1857 by A.Gibson
Sold to Captain Lars Hansson Sjöström, Vitemölla, 1885. Hometown was Simrishamn. Sold in 1900 to Håkan Larsson, Brantevik.
Commander:
1885 Lars Hansson, Sjöström
1893 Josef Thomasson
1894 Nils Svensson
1901 Lars Håkansson
all Vitemölla
Maria Adelaide ran a leak in the North Sea on 2/7 1905 approx. 95 miles from Spurm Point due to storm. She was loaded with coal from West Hartlepool for Trelleborg. The crew, 10 men, saved themselves in the lifeboats and were picked up by the British trawler Illfacombe, which the next day landed them in Grimsby.
